Turtle Beach announced the Command Series KB7, KP7, and KB5 keyboards on April 23, 2024. The company released all three models simultaneously in the United States on that date. The announcement introduced new hardware to the gaming peripheral market.

All three keyboards utilize Hall effect magnetic switches rated for 150 million keystrokes. The KB7 and KP7 models feature an 8kHz polling rate. The KB7 includes a 4.5-inch Command Touch screen with built-in OBS and Streamlabs integration. The KP7 serves as a companion numpad for the KB7. The KB5 model offers a full-size layout with a 2.4-inch Command Touch display and ReacTap advanced key functionality.

The Command Series KB7 carries a price of 199.99 USD in the United States. The KP7 companion numpad costs 99.99 USD. The KB5 keyboard is available for 149.99 USD. All three products launched in the US market on the announcement date.

Hall effect switches and touch screens define the new lineup

The Command Series lineup expands Turtle Beach's hardware options with magnetic switch technology. The inclusion of dedicated touch screens on the KB7 and KB5 models allows for direct streaming control and key customization. The simultaneous release of the main keyboard, numpad, and full-size variant provides users with flexible configuration choices for their gaming setups.
